Double Glazing Repairs Near Me

Window-Repairs.-150x150.jpgDouble glazing can improve the aesthetics and value of your home. Over time, UPVC windows may develop issues that require fixing.

These issues can cause leaks, draughts and condensation if they aren't taken care of. Many of these problems can be resolved without having to replace the entire window.

Broken panes

A baseball that shatters or a sudden storm can cause a double-pane window to shatter and expose your home to the elements. While you can replace a single pane of glass yourself, the best option is to have both windows replaced to keep your energy efficiency. You can fix a damaged glass window with a few simple tools and techniques.

Begin by taped-over the damaged area of the window with packing tape to stop it from fracturing further. This accomplishes two important tasks it stabilizes the crack and stops air from entering through the gap.

Then, take off the old glaze using a utility knife. Wear protective glasses and gloves to avoid cuts. Scrape the surface around the window and take out any metal glaziers points (the tiny clips that hold the window frames together), if they are present. Finalize, measure the opening of the new glass pane and subtract one eighth inch from each side. This will ensure that your new glass is perfectly positioned in the frame.

Once you have the new measurements and measurements, use a utility knife to cut the new pane and then install it inside the frame. Make use of a putty blade to smooth out the compound on both sides of the pane and on the frame to ensure it matches the rest of the window. Once the compound is dry and dried, paint it with exterior house painting to finish.

It is also possible to repair a damaged window by cutting the window with a razor blade just beyond the crack, curving around it. This will stop the crack from expanding and will keep your window in good shape while you wait for a professional to repair it.

Misted double glazing is another frequent issue that can be fixed by a double-glazed repair company. The procedure is similar to fixing a damaged pane: take off the pane, determine the reason for the mist (normally condensation or an issue with the seal) Clean the panes, and then seal them. Be cautious when trying to fix the issue yourself. It's not an easy task to do without the right tools and can be risky if you do not know what you're doing.

Misted panes

Double glazing will eventually develop problems that are known as "misting". This happens when moisture enters the space between the glass panes, and it causes condensation. It is good to know that most of the time, this can be repaired without needing to replace windows. However it is crucial to realize that this is not DIY and requires specialized tools are required. Therefore, this is normally better left to an experienced window repair service.

How to fix foggy double glazed windows

The issue of misty double glazing is caused by the seal between two glass panes deteriorates and allows moisture into the space. This could be because of poor installation, temperature fluctuations, or even the aging of the sealed unit itself. Whatever the cause, it is vital that the issue is addressed as soon as possible to prevent further damage.

The moisture that is trapped in double-glazed windows can cause many problems, including dampness, mold, and rot. These can all be harmful to your health. It can also affect the insulation properties of your windows, Double Glazing Repairs Near Me resulting in higher energy bills.

One of the main causes for the accumulation of moisture between double-glazed windows is the lack of ventilation. This is especially true when your windows are situated near dryers, radiators or other heating sources. The heat from these appliances heats the air, it creates water vapour which then seeps into the gap between the glass panes. If this problem is not taken care of, the glass will soon start to fog up.

Dehumidifiers or plug-ins can help to prevent moisture from getting between your double glazed window. They can help reduce humidity in your home and keep condensation away. Alternatively, Double Glazing Repairs Near Me you could look into upgrading your double glazed window to use the most recent A-rated energy efficient glass which can save you even more money on your heating bills.

Draughts

A draught (also written as draft) is an air current that circulates or enters an enclosed space. It could be a natural phenomenon, such as a breeze, however it could also be an artificial phenomenon for HVAC systems, for instance. The ability to control draughts is vital in various contexts, including HVAC, architecture and personal comfort.

Draughts can be a problem through windows that can be closed or opened however, they can also enter through double glazing panes and within the frames. If you notice a draughty unit it could be because the seals are not closed. It is essential to repair this as soon as you can.

It's also important to check whether draught-proofing is installed at the bottom of your doors. Installing a hinged-flap draught excluder to the bottom of your doors will block cold air from getting in and heat from leaving. Filling in gaps around your door frame can be done using foam or brush strips.

Draught proofing won't just keep your home warm, but will also save you money by allowing you to lower the thermostat. The stoppage of draughts can cost you between PS25 to PS50 per year.

Draughts can be harmful. They can trigger health issues, including colds and asthma. A draught may cause condensation and mold to develop. This is especially true when your windows aren't sealed, so it's essential to repair and check any draughts as soon you are able to detect them.

If you're concerned about the condition of your double glazing contact a professional. They'll be able to examine your windows and offer an estimate for repairs. In most cases, they can be carried out quickly and efficiently, without the necessity for replacement windows.

Leaks

Double-glazed windows and doors are designed to keep water out of your home, therefore it's essential to ensure that they're functioning properly. It's important to contact an expert if you spot any leaks in your double glazing. It could be that the seals on your windows are worn out or something is blocking the drainage area.

If you notice condensation in between the panes in your double-glazed window, it could be a sign of a blow-off seal. This happens when the gas that insulates it escapes, allowing ordinary air to enter. The vacuum created could cause the glass in the double glazing to melt, causing a hole. If the damage isn't repaired promptly, the double glazing unit will have to be changed.

It is possible that the black plastic on your double-glazed window is misty. This could be an indication of a worn rubber seal that must be replaced. A new seal will aid in preventing draughts and keep your house warm and cosy.

Sometimes, you can fix small issues with your double glazing by applying oil to the hinges, mechanisms handles, or the areas where they pass through the frame. It is best to leave the work to an expert repair service for double glazing near me glazing. These firms will have the right tools to solve these issues and you can be sure that they will complete the task correctly.
